Страница 1 из 1

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 13:42
SilentNess
Все привет, помогите решить проблему, настроен астериск с freepbx
Сервер астериск связан потоком dahdi c аналоговой АТС Panasonic,
из нее получаем входящий вызов по внутренним номерам, он заходит через
контекст from trunk, и через поток выходит на городские линии (этот поток заведен уже на
АТС астериск) и вызов выходит через контекст from zaptel на город т.е. транзитный выход через
астериск.
Проблема заключается в том что неудается заставить выйти звонок через custom context т.е. через определенный присвоенный внутреннему пиру городской номер.

Есть предположение что входящий вызов из Panasonica на астериск надо принимать через
DID-каналы, и направлять в контекст, но результата добиться не удалось.

Может подскажите хотя бы направление ?

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 13:47
ded
Завести канал от Панасоника в контекст from-internal.

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 13:59
SilentNess
завел, ситуация прежняя, причем для SIP пиров которые на астериске контекст отрабатывается как положено, т.е. проблема именно при звонка с Panasonika

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 14:15
ded
вы знаете как мониторить прохождение вызовов через CLI?
Там в общем то всё понятно, и сразу видна причина.

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 14:46
Vlad1983
custom context нужно ещё понять
я доходил до его логики минут 40 при активном использовании выхлопа консоли при вызове и dialplan show ...

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 14:50
SilentNess
у меня
панасоник
group=0
switchtype=qsig
signalling=pri_cpe
context=from-internal
channel => 1-15, 17-31

город
group=1
context=from-zaptel
switchtype=qsig
callerid=asreceived
channels => 32-46, 48-62

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 15:00
ded
город
group=1
context=from-trunk
switchtype=qsig
callerid=asreceived
channels => 32-46, 48-62
SilentNess писал(а):Проблема заключается в том что неудается заставить выйти звонок через custom context т.е. через определенный присвоенный внутреннему пиру городской номер.
Укажите этому внутреннему номеру параметр Oubound CID в формате, который принимает город. Note: это должен быть один из ваших DIDs.
Custom context не нужен.

Re: Custom Context для транзитного вызова через астериск

Добавлено: 01 ноя 2012, 15:17
SilentNess
все спасибо, заработало